Begin a spiritually uplifting journey to the sacred origins of two of India's holiest rivers with our Gangotri Yamunotri Tour Package. Designed for pilgrims seeking a shorter yet deeply meaningful Char Dham experience, this 4 Nights / 5 Days itinerary covers the revered temples of Yamunotri, dedicated to Goddess Yamuna, and Gangotri, the sacred abode of Goddess Ganga. Starting from Haridwar, the journey takes you through the breathtaking landscapes of Uttarakhand, where snow-capped peaks, lush forests, river valleys, and charming Himalayan towns create a serene setting for your pilgrimage.

Your first destination is Yamunotri, the source of the holy Yamuna River and one of the four sacred Char Dham shrines. Reached via a scenic trek from Janki Chatti, the temple is surrounded by towering mountains, hot water springs, and spiritual landmarks such as Surya Kund and Divya Shila. The journey then continues to Gangotri, where the sacred River Ganga is believed to have descended to Earth through the penance of King Bhagirath. Nestled along the banks of the Bhagirathi River, Gangotri Temple offers a peaceful atmosphere amidst majestic Himalayan scenery.

Beyond the temples, this pilgrimage introduces you to the natural beauty and spiritual heritage of Uttarakhand. Drive through Mussoorie, admire the cascading Kempty Falls, visit the ancient Kashi Vishwanath Temple in Uttarkashi, and witness the pristine Bhagirathi River flowing through picturesque valleys.

Travel Itinerary

Day 1 - Haridwar – Mussoorie – Barkot

Arrival Day
Your pilgrimage begins with a warm welcome in Haridwar before driving towards Barkot through the scenic foothills of Uttarakhand. En route, pass through Dehradun and the popular hill station of Mussoorie, known for its pleasant climate and panoramic Himalayan views. Stop at the picturesque Kempty Falls, where the cascading waters provide a refreshing break amidst nature. Continue your drive through winding mountain roads, pine forests, and charming villages before arriving in Barkot, a peaceful town nestled along the Yamuna River. Overnight Stay: Barkot

Day 2 - Barkot – Janki Chatti – Yamunotri – Uttarkashi

Travel to Janki Chatti, the starting point of the trek to Yamunotri. The picturesque trail takes you through forests, waterfalls, mountain streams, and breathtaking Himalayan scenery. Upon reaching Yamunotri Temple, offer prayers to Goddess Yamuna and visit the sacred Surya Kund and Divya Shila, both important pilgrimage sites associated with the temple. After completing the darshan, return to Janki Chatti and continue the drive to Uttarkashi, situated on the banks of the Bhagirathi River. Overnight Stay: Uttarkashi

Day 3 - Uttarkashi – Gangotri – Uttarkashi

Today's excursion takes you to the sacred Gangotri Temple, one of the holiest shrines dedicated to Goddess Ganga. Drive through the spectacular Bhagirathi Valley, passing dense forests, mountain villages, and dramatic Himalayan landscapes. Spend time at the temple and along the pristine riverbanks, where pilgrims perform prayers and rituals. The peaceful surroundings and fresh mountain air make Gangotri one of the most spiritually rewarding destinations in Uttarakhand. Return to Uttarkashi by evening. Overnight Stay: Uttarkashi

Day 4 - Uttarkashi – Shri Vishwanath Temple – Haridwar

Before leaving Uttarkashi, visit the revered Kashi Vishwanath Temple, one of the oldest temples dedicated to Lord Shiva in Uttarakhand. The temple is known for its peaceful ambiance and deep spiritual significance. Continue the scenic drive back through mountain valleys, rivers, and forests towards Haridwar. Along the way, enjoy the changing landscapes as the Himalayas gradually give way to the plains. Upon arrival, check into your hotel and spend the evening exploring Har Ki Pauri or attending the famous Ganga Aarti (optional). Overnight Stay: Haridwar

Day 5 - Departure from Haridwar

Your spiritual journey concludes today. Depending on your departure schedule, you may spend some leisure time visiting nearby temples or local markets before being transferred to the railway station, bus stand, or your preferred drop-off point. Leave with cherished memories and the divine blessings of Goddess Yamuna and Goddess Ganga.

Q4. 12. What is Char Dham Yatra and when does it start in 2026?

Ans. Char Dham Yatra includes visits to: Kedarnath Badrinath Yamunotri & Gangotri It usually starts around April/May (Akshaya Tritiya) and ends in October/November.
